SOME HISTOLOGICAL STUDIES ON THE PANCREATIC ISLET CELLS IN TURKEY (Maleagris gallopavo)
Pancreatic islets of Turkey were different from those of mammals. It is divided into alpha, beta and mixed types according to the ground of cellular composition.
